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3651448994 99737 7623 173 954
90531795 35494400 1027556
90531795 35494400 1027556
0036710792 426067 4171 3989
All about undefined
Interested in learning more?
90531795 35494400 1027556
0036710792 426067 4171 3989
See more
508674 29131611741 322477
4168020 181 8450
See more
669 11237675
53 62973883 9915 796708
See more